[Bozeman, Montana] – XOVERLAND, a leader in the overlanding community, known for its captivating travel documentaries and inspiring adventures, is thrilled to announce the creation of Overland Collective, alongside the acquisition of Overland Journal and expeditionportal.com.

Overland Collective brings together XOVERLAND, Overland Journal, Expedition Portal, and XOVERLAND Ranch under one unified banner and represents a strategic collaboration to strengthen the individual platforms while benefiting the overlanding community as a whole. This new house of brands marks a significant milestone in the overland industry and reinforces XOVERLAND’s commitment to building the world’s largest and most authoritative overland media collective.

“Together, we will cultivate a content collective where overlanders can find inspiration, resources, and a sense of community,” said Clay Croft. The inception of this partnership can be traced back to 2009 when Clay Croft picked up an Overland Journal at a local dealership. Over the past 16 years, Clay and Scott Brady have developed a friendship that has included expeditions across the Road of Bones in Russia, South America, and the first south-to-north vehicle crossing of the Greenland Ice Sheet.
With this acquisition, XOVERLAND aims to retain the editorial integrity of Overland Journal while expanding its reach to both international travelers and domestic overlanders. Rachelle Croft will serve as Chief Executive Officer, Clay Croft as Chief Creative Officer, and Scott Brady as Executive Publisher. About Overland Collective: As the world’s largest overland community, Overland Collective serves vehicle-based travelers through a diverse range of platforms, including XOVERLAND video and film productions, Overland Journal print and digital magazine, Expedition Portal website and forum, The Overland Journal Podcast, XOVERLAND Ranch venue and events, and numerous expeditions. Together, the Overland Collective team has circumnavigated the globe four times, visited over 160 countries, and is the first in history to have crossed all seven continents by vehicle—and they are just getting started.
